Key Responsibilities
- Develop electrical substation drawings including single line diagrams, schematics, wiring diagrams, physical layouts, sections and elevations, and other related details and sketches
- Perform design calculations and analysis such as grounding system analysis, lightning protection, voltage drop, power system sizing (AC and DC), and other industry-standard calculations
- Work closely with designers and drafters to develop drawings of high quality both technically and aesthetically
- Develop technical equipment and construction specifications, work scopes, estimates, and recommendation reports as needed by the project
- Work closely with Engineers to develop foundation and structure drawings, including mounting patterns and equipment layouts
